区块链自动化测试-洞察及研究.docxVIP

  • 14
  • 0
  • 约2.57万字
  • 约 50页
  • 2025-09-23 发布于浙江
  • 举报

PAGE40/NUMPAGES50

区块链自动化测试

TOC\o1-3\h\z\u

第一部分区块链测试概述 2

第二部分自动化测试必要性 8

第三部分测试环境搭建 14

第四部分测试用例设计 18

第五部分智能合约测试 25

第六部分性能测试方法 29

第七部分安全测试策略 36

第八部分测试结果分析 40

第一部分区块链测试概述

关键词

关键要点

区块链测试的定义与重要性

1.区块链测试是对区块链系统功能、性能、安全性和可用性进行全面评估的过程,旨在确保系统符合预期目标和行业标准。

2.区块链测试的重要性在于其去中心化、不可篡改和透明性等特点,要求测试需覆盖分布式环境下的多节点交互和数据一致性验证。

3.随着区块链技术广泛应用于金融、供应链等领域,测试的复杂性和严谨性不断提升,需结合智能合约审计和共识机制模拟进行综合评估。

区块链测试的类型与方法

1.区块链测试可分为单元测试、集成测试、系统测试和性能测试,其中单元测试针对智能合约代码,系统测试验证全网交互逻辑。

2.常用测试方法包括模拟测试、真实环境测试和压力测试,模拟测试通过搭建私有链环境验证功能正确性,真实环境测试则需考虑外部节点干扰。

3.性能测试需关注TP

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档